What is Youth Arts Online?
An accessible online space to create and connect.
Each week, join Mal and Ink on Zoom to try a different creative activity and connect as a community.
This is a six week project running over the Summer holidays and we would love to welcome you to come to as many sessions as you would like.
When are the workshops?
Workshop 1 – Tuesday July 4th at 7:00-8:30pm (with breaks)
Welcome Games: Relaxed session to get to know each other and play some games – but don’t worry if you can’t make it we will do introductions at the start of each session.
Workshop 2 – Tuesday July 11th at 7:00-8:30pm (with breaks)
Character Creation: Do you have a favourite character, maybe two or three? What would happen if you took the best bits from each one and combined them?
Workshop 3 – Tuesday July 18th at 7:00-8:30pm (with breaks)
Stage Boxes: Miniature models of theatre stages can be used by designers but also to make a show more accessible. Lets make one – what has the right colours, the right textures?
Workshop 4 – Tuesday July 25th at 7:00-8:30pm (with breaks)
Storytelling and Plot: Combining the brains of everyone in the room lets make a story together.
Workshop 5 – Tuesday August 1st at 7:00-8:30pm (with breaks)
Intro to film: Let’s play with cameras – we won’t have time to make a whole film in this session but we’re excited to have fun trying!
Workshop 6 – Tuesday August 8th at 7:00-8:30pm (with breaks)
Summer Holiday Postcards: What would your dream holiday be? Where would you go, who would be with you, what would you see?

Who can take part?
*This space is for you if you are you’re D/deaf, disabled, chronically ill or your access needs are not met by the creative/social spaces in your area (or the transport options to get there).
After you sign up, you will receive an online form to tell us about any access supports you might need to take part in the project (for example, sign language interpretation, live captioning, digital breakout space etc.), so that we can arrange this for the sessions you want to attend.
For this project, you must be aged 13-18. We hope to run projects with other age groups in the future.
